Why finance needs orchestration rather than isolated AI tools
Many finance teams have experimented with AI Copilots, Generative AI summaries or standalone OCR tools. These can improve individual tasks, but they rarely solve enterprise coordination problems. A finance process usually spans multiple systems, owners and control points. A purchase request may begin in operations, require procurement validation, trigger budget checks in finance, involve legal review for terms, affect inventory planning and ultimately influence cash flow forecasting. If AI is only used to summarize an email or classify a document, the enterprise still suffers from fragmented execution. Workflow orchestration connects these steps into a governed sequence, combining Workflow Automation, Enterprise Integration and AI-assisted Decision Support.
This matters because finance performance depends on dependencies outside finance. Delayed goods receipts distort accruals. Weak master data affects payables and reporting. Poor contract visibility creates revenue leakage. Unstructured documents slow approvals and increase audit effort. AI workflow orchestration helps finance coordinate with adjacent functions by routing work based on policy, surfacing relevant knowledge, recommending next actions and escalating exceptions before they become control failures.
What AI workflow orchestration looks like in an enterprise finance operating model
At an enterprise level, AI workflow orchestration is the coordinated execution layer between business users, ERP transactions, documents, policies, analytics and AI services. It combines rules-based automation with probabilistic AI capabilities. Rules remain essential for approvals, segregation of duties, compliance thresholds and posting logic. AI adds value where context, ambiguity or prediction are involved, such as extracting invoice data through Intelligent Document Processing and OCR, identifying likely coding errors, forecasting cash positions, recommending approvers, summarizing policy exceptions or retrieving relevant contract clauses through Enterprise Search and Semantic Search.
In practice, the orchestration layer can trigger actions across Odoo Accounting, Purchase, Inventory, Documents, Project, Helpdesk, CRM and Knowledge when those applications are part of the finance process. For example, Odoo Documents can centralize supporting records, Odoo Purchase can enforce procurement controls, Odoo Accounting can manage journal and payment workflows, and Odoo Knowledge can provide policy context to reviewers. The orchestration logic should not replace ERP discipline. It should strengthen it by ensuring that people, systems and AI services act in sequence with traceability.
| Finance challenge | Orchestration response | Business impact |
|---|---|---|
| Invoice exceptions across departments | Route documents, extract fields, validate against purchase and receipt data, escalate mismatches with Human-in-the-loop Workflows | Faster resolution with stronger control and auditability |
| Budget approvals delayed by unclear ownership | Use policy-driven routing, AI summaries and recommendation systems for approver selection | Shorter approval cycles and clearer accountability |
| Cash forecasting based on stale inputs | Combine ERP transactions, pipeline signals and Predictive Analytics in a coordinated workflow | Better liquidity visibility and planning confidence |
| Month-end close bottlenecks | Sequence tasks, detect blockers, surface missing documents and prioritize exceptions | More predictable close process and reduced manual chasing |
| Policy interpretation varies by team | Use RAG over approved finance policies and Knowledge Management assets | More consistent decisions and lower compliance risk |

A decision framework for selecting the right finance orchestration use cases
Not every finance process should be AI-enabled first. Leaders should prioritize use cases where coordination complexity is high, business value is visible and governance can be designed upfront. A useful decision framework evaluates five dimensions: process friction, financial materiality, data readiness, control sensitivity and change adoption. High-friction workflows with repeated handoffs and document dependency are often strong candidates. So are processes where delays affect cash, margin, supplier continuity or executive reporting. However, if source data is unreliable or policy ownership is unclear, orchestration should begin with process and data discipline before advanced AI is introduced.
| Decision dimension | Key question | Executive guidance |
|---|---|---|
| Process friction | How many handoffs, exceptions and manual follow-ups exist? | Prioritize workflows with visible coordination breakdowns |
| Financial materiality | Does the process affect cash, margin, compliance or reporting quality? | Focus on workflows tied to measurable business outcomes |
| Data readiness | Are ERP records, documents and master data reliable enough for orchestration? | Fix foundational data issues before scaling AI |
| Control sensitivity | What approvals, audit trails and segregation rules must remain intact? | Design AI Governance and Human-in-the-loop controls early |
| Adoption feasibility | Will business users trust and use the workflow in daily operations? | Start where user pain is real and benefits are obvious |
Reference architecture choices that support control without slowing innovation
A practical architecture for finance orchestration should be cloud-native, API-first and observable. The ERP remains the system of record. The orchestration layer coordinates events, approvals, AI services and integrations. Document repositories and Knowledge Management assets provide policy and evidence context. Business Intelligence supports performance visibility. Identity and Access Management enforces role-based access, while Security and Compliance controls govern data handling. For enterprises with advanced AI requirements, Large Language Models may be accessed through OpenAI or Azure OpenAI, or through self-managed model options such as Qwen where data residency or customization matters. RAG can be supported by Vector Databases for policy retrieval and contextual grounding. Components such as PostgreSQL and Redis may support transactional and caching needs, while Kubernetes and Docker can help standardize deployment and scaling in managed environments.
Technology selection should follow risk and operating model requirements, not trend pressure. For example, a finance team may need a lightweight orchestration layer for approvals and document routing, while a global shared services model may require broader Enterprise Search, multilingual document handling, model routing and Monitoring. Tools such as LiteLLM or vLLM may be relevant where enterprises need model abstraction or efficient inference management. n8n may fit selected workflow integration scenarios, but only if it aligns with enterprise governance, supportability and security expectations. The architecture should always preserve traceability of prompts, outputs, approvals and downstream actions.
Implementation roadmap: from controlled pilot to enterprise operating capability
The most successful programs do not begin with a broad AI mandate. They begin with one or two finance workflows where coordination pain is clear, stakeholders are committed and controls can be tested. Phase one should define the target process, decision rights, exception paths, data sources and success measures. Phase two should integrate ERP transactions, documents and policy content, then introduce AI only where it improves throughput or decision quality. Phase three should establish Monitoring, Observability and AI Evaluation so leaders can assess accuracy, latency, user behavior and control adherence. Phase four should scale to adjacent workflows using reusable patterns for approvals, retrieval, document intake and escalation.

Governance, risk and the controls finance leaders should insist on
Finance cannot delegate accountability to AI. Any orchestration initiative must be designed around AI Governance, Responsible AI and explicit control ownership. Human-in-the-loop Workflows are essential for material approvals, policy exceptions, unusual journal activity, supplier changes and any action with regulatory or financial statement implications. Model Lifecycle Management should define how prompts, retrieval sources, models and thresholds are versioned and reviewed. AI Evaluation should test not only accuracy but also consistency, explainability, escalation behavior and failure handling. Monitoring and Observability should capture workflow bottlenecks, model drift, retrieval quality and user override patterns.
- Keep the ERP as the authoritative source for transactions, approvals and audit trails.
- Limit AI autonomy in high-risk finance actions; use Agentic AI selectively and only with bounded permissions.
- Ground Generative AI outputs with approved enterprise content through RAG rather than open-ended generation.
- Apply role-based access, data masking and retention policies to protect sensitive financial and employee information.
- Measure override rates, exception rates and downstream correction effort to detect hidden quality issues.
Common mistakes that weaken ROI and trust
A common mistake is treating finance AI as a user interface project rather than an operating model change. A polished assistant cannot compensate for broken handoffs, poor master data or unclear approval authority. Another mistake is over-automating sensitive decisions before governance is mature. Enterprises also underestimate the importance of retrieval quality in RAG-based policy support. If the knowledge base is outdated, fragmented or poorly curated, the AI will scale inconsistency rather than reduce it. Finally, many programs fail to define business ROI in finance terms. Leaders should track cycle time, exception resolution speed, working capital impact, close predictability, audit readiness and user adoption rather than generic model metrics alone.
